Are you a passionate educator looking to join a welcoming and supportive school community that values collaboration, professional growth, and pupil wellbeing? An exciting opportunity has arisen for a dedicated Key Stage 2 teacher to join a vibrant two-form entry primary school in the Hoddesdon area from April 2026. This is a full-time, permanent position. Ideally, the successful candidate will be placed in Year 6, although this is open to discussion. Applications are welcomed from both experienced teachers and strong Early Career Teachers (ECTs).

This well-regarded, Church of England primary school is situated in a thriving market town, with excellent transport links to the A10, M25, and M11. The school enjoys a strong reputation in the local community and was recently rated 'Good' by Ofsted (2023). With a diverse pupil intake and a strong emphasis on inclusion and values-based education, the school fosters a positive and nurturing environment where every child is encouraged to 'let their light shine'.

The dedicated Inclusion Team works alongside families to provide tailored support and early intervention strategies that promote both academic and personal development. Staff wellbeing and professional development are high priorities for the senior leadership team. The school offers a range of research-informed CPD opportunities and has a culture of collaboration, care, and continuous improvement. Teachers are supported in maintaining a healthy work-life balance while delivering high-quality education.

How to prepare for a job interview at Academics Ltd

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you’re well-versed in the National Curriculum and the specific needs of Key Stage 2 pupils. Brush up on your subject knowledge, especially if you're aiming for Year 6. This will show that you’re not just passionate but also prepared to deliver high-quality education.

✨Show Your Passion for Inclusion

This school values inclusion and diversity, so be ready to discuss how you’ve supported different learners in your classroom. Share specific examples of strategies you've used to ensure every child can thrive, as this aligns with their ethos of letting every child 'shine'.

✨Emphasise Professional Development

Highlight your commitment to continuous improvement and professional growth. Talk about any CPD opportunities you’ve pursued and how they’ve impacted your teaching. This will resonate with the school's focus on staff wellbeing and development.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some insightful questions about the school’s approach to collaboration and support for teachers. This shows that you’re genuinely interested in being part of their community and are keen to contribute positively to their culture.
